Mps suspended a Parliamentary inquiry into the cash for peerages row yesterday after police warned it could undermine their criminal investigation.
The Commons Public Administration Committee postponed further hearings as part of its inquiry into propriety in the honours system.
The committee's Labour chairman, Tony Wright, said it did not want to prejudice an investigation by the Metropolitan Police.
"It's pretty clear that some of the witnesses that we have identified are very much in the frame as far as the police are concerned, " he said.
